where is the prom chip?

i need to identify what chip im using. where can i find it. and how can i identify it? my car came stock with a 305tpi, but a 350 was dropped in, how much does that chip hinder my performence?

Originally posted by Trent257
i need to identify what chip im using. where can i find it.
The chip is in the computer. The computer is under the dash, passenger side. Two screws hold the cover plate on the computer (ECM) so remove them and the plate and look inside. The big blue rectangular thing is the MEMCAL which contains the chip.

and how can i identify it?
If it's a GM piece there will be a 4-letter code on the chip. If it's an aftermarket, there will probably be something indicating who made it.

how much does that chip hinder my performence?
Depends on what chip you have. Pretty much all mass-produced chips are lacking...they're not configured specifically for your setup.
